Emerson Rosemount 8600 Utility Vortex Flow Meters

The Rosemount 8600 Vortex flow meter is optimized for general purpose flow metering and utility applications including clean fluids and steam flow. The 8600 Vortex meter offers enhanced reliability and simplified maintenance with superior vibration immunity without any moving parts. Installation is easy with no impulse lines or zeroing required and internal verification of both the electronics and sensor add enhanced process insight

Description

  • Ensure reliability and cut costs with no moving parts to repair or maintain
  • Eliminate impulse lines and plugging issues with inline technology
  • Simplify installation with no impulse lines or field calibration or zeroing required
  • Cover a broad span of flow rates with wide rangeability
  • Electronics verification enables simplified troubleshooting
  • Perform easy maintenance with replaceable sensors
  • Remote mount electronics offered for easy access

Specifications

Flow Meter Accuracy

± 0.75% of volumetric rate for liquids
± 1% of volumetric rate for gas and steam
± 2% of rate for mass flow on steam using 8600 MultiVariable (MTA option)

Turndown

30:1

Output

4-20 mA with HART® 5
4-20 mA with HART® 5 and scalable pulse output

Wetted Material

Stainless Steel – CF3M & CF8M

Flange Options

ANSI Class 150 and 300
DIN PN 10 and PN 40

Process Temperature Limits

-58°F to 482°F (-50°C to 250°C)

Temperature Sensor Range Using 8600 MultiVariable (MTA option)

-40 to 800°F (-40 to 427°C)

Line Size

1 to 8-in; 25 to 200 mm
